What recent analyst data show

Aggregated analyst data compiled by Zacks Investment Research indicate an average 12-month price target for Microsoft around $528.88, based on short-term forecasts from roughly 40 analysts covering the stock. That implies double-digit percentage upside versus recent trading levels.

MarketBeat data similarly point to a consensus target above $560, with the average figure reported at about $561.20 and a coverage universe of several dozen brokerages following the Nasdaq-listed name. These consensus numbers underscore that most covering banks still model further gains despite the strong multi-year run.

The product behind the stock

Microsoft generates the bulk of its revenue from a mix of cloud services, software subscriptions and productivity tools, with its Azure cloud platform and the Microsoft 365 suite at the center of its business model. Additional growth drivers include AI-powered Copilot offerings embedded across its product range.
